Mesothelioma Attorneys

A mesothelioma attorney can help you to file an asbestos trust fund claim, a personal injury lawsuit or a wrongful-death lawsuit. They will also discover which asbestos companies are responsible for your exposure.

Due to the long mesothelioma's latency period, it can be difficult to recall when or the location to which you were exposed. A mesothelioma lawyer who is experienced will use unique resources to determine this information.

Civil trials are akin to trials in civil cases.

Mesothelioma suits can be complex. However, many cases are settled prior to trial. If the case does go to trial, a jury will determine the amount of compensation a victim is entitled to. A verdict at trial could also be appealed. This could delay compensation payments by months or even years.

Personal injury lawsuits comprise the majority of mesothelioma lawsuits filed in the United States. They seek financial compensation to pay for medical expenses, lost wages, and other expenses. Compensation from a mesothelioma suit can't restore health or bring back a loved one, but it can help victims and their families get the best possible treatment.

The discovery process can last months as attorneys collect evidence and question witnesses. An attorney for mesothelioma will interview current and former workers who may have valuable information regarding asbestos exposure. They will also collect medical documents to prove that asbestos exposure resulted in a mesothelioma diagnosis. During this stage, a patient may be required to give a deposition that can be recorded and played to the jury in the event of a trial.

In wrongful death lawsuits, the plaintiff seeks compensation for a family member's death caused by mesothelioma, or another asbestos-related illness. These lawsuits seek justice by holding accountable individuals accountable for their negligence in exposed victims to asbestos. The lawsuits for wrongful death are filed by spouses or children of dependents who have lost a loved one.

A mesothelioma lawyer can also help victims determine the amount of compensation they are eligible to receive. Compensation for a mesothelioma case could include punitive, non-economic and economic damages. Economic damages may include reimbursements for past and future medical expenses, lost wages, and funeral costs. Non-economic damages include discomfort and pain, loss of consortium and emotional distress. Punitive damages are intended to discourage asbestos companies from engaging with fraudulent, oppressive or grossly negligent behavior.

In addition, mesothelioma lawyers can assist victims and their families in filing lawsuits for wrongful deaths. Wrongful Death claims are similar to personal injury lawsuits and seek compensation for a loved one's death caused by asbestos exposure. These claims can be filed by spouses, children or other family members who were close to asbestos victims.
